The Nashville Predators would like to offer a new program for amateur and youth hockey coaches for their commitment to the sport of hockey.
Experience a unique hockey educational opportunity that will assist you in your pursuit to become the best coach you can be! The Nashville Predators are teaming up with the youth hockey community to present tools that any coach can use to improve his or her own abilities and, in turn, the team’s on ice performance. The Nashville Predators will offer a FREE coaching symposium with members of the Nashville Predators coaching staff at the Sommet Center. Ice and inline hockey coaches of all levels can take away from this clinic information and resources about a wide variety of coaching topics to better execute practices and experiences to youth hockey players allowing them to develop into better skilled players.
Don’t miss your opportunity to learn and interact with leaders in the hockey community. Space is limited and advanced registration is required. Register by early to be automatically entered to win a 2009-10 team autographed Nashville Predators jersey.
Registration for the FREE Nashville Predators Coaching Symposium will include:
• One complimentary Upper Level Goal Zone ticket to Predators game at Sommet Center.
• Exclusive access to view the Predators morning practice with Radio Play-by-Play, Tom Callahan.
• Food and Beverage.
• Classroom style lecture hosted by Predators TV Play-by-Play, Pete Weber featuring Predators Head Coach Barry Trotz, Associate Coach Brent Peterson and Strength and Conditioning Coach David Good.
• Topics discussed will cover how to set up effective practices, on-ice drills, special teams, team building, off-ice training techniques and much more that can be useful to coaches of all age and skill levels.
• Keepsake gift.
• Opportunity to purchase additional discounted tickets to the Predators preseason game that evening.
